To calculate percentiles manually, you must first rank the values or scores you want to compare and analyze in order of smallest to largest.
Multiply k (the percent) by n (the total number of values in your data set). The resulting figure is your index, which you’ll refer to as the position of a specific value or score in your data set, i.e. first, second, third, and so forth. If your index is not a whole round number, round it up or down, whichever is the closer whole number to it.
Next, use the ranked data set to determine your percentile, referring to your index. The value for the kth percentile must be greater than the values that come before the index. Thus, the next ranked value would be the kth percentile.

Percentile represents data in comparison with other data within a specific set. Percentage, meanwhile, is used to express the ratio between a part and a whole per 100.
Because it compares data against those within the same data set, percentile is used to evaluate performance and identify outliers. It’s also useful in doing risk assessment in finance and investment since it can evaluate and calculate returns.
On the other hand, percentage can be used to compare various quantities of an object. For example, the amount of items in basket A is 50% higher than the amount of items in basket B. It can also be applied to compare the quantities of two different objects, such as determining if a student that got 620 correct answers out of 700 questions scored better than another student who got 580 out of 600 questions right. Percentage is also utilized when calculating ratio and proportion.
